Definition

3D modeling is the process of creating a three-dimensional representation of an object or scene using specialized software. This technique allows for the visualization, manipulation, and rendering of digital objects in a virtual space, making it essential for various fields like design, gaming, and architecture. 3D modeling enables creators to produce detailed representations that can be animated or rendered into realistic images, providing a foundational element for industries that rely on multimedia technology.

5 Must Know Facts For Your Next Test

  1. 3D modeling is widely used in the film industry for creating visual effects and animated characters, allowing filmmakers to bring imaginative worlds to life.
  2. In architecture and product design, 3D modeling helps visualize concepts before they are built, aiding in the planning and presentation phases.
  3. Many video games rely on 3D modeling to create immersive environments and detailed character designs, enhancing player experience.
  4. 3D printing technology has benefited significantly from advances in 3D modeling, allowing designers to create prototypes and custom products with precision.
  5. Virtual reality experiences utilize 3D models to create engaging environments that users can explore interactively, blurring the lines between real and virtual worlds.

Review Questions

  • How does 3D modeling contribute to the development of virtual environments in multimedia applications?
    • 3D modeling is crucial in developing virtual environments as it provides the foundational visual elements that users interact with. By creating realistic and detailed models, designers can craft immersive experiences that enhance engagement. This capability is especially important in gaming and simulation software, where users expect high levels of detail and interaction within these digital spaces.
  • What role does 3D modeling play in enhancing user experiences in augmented reality applications?
    • In augmented reality applications, 3D modeling serves as a bridge between digital content and the real world by overlaying computer-generated objects onto live views. This enhances user experiences by allowing for interactive and contextual engagement with virtual elements in real time. As users interact with these 3D models within their environment, it creates a more enriching experience, making learning and entertainment more dynamic.
  • Evaluate the impact of advancements in 3D modeling technologies on industries such as entertainment, healthcare, and education.
    • Advancements in 3D modeling technologies have revolutionized multiple industries by improving both efficiency and creativity. In entertainment, filmmakers use sophisticated modeling techniques to create stunning visuals that were once impossible. In healthcare, accurate 3D models assist in surgical planning and medical training simulations. Meanwhile, in education, interactive models enhance learning through visualization, helping students grasp complex concepts more effectively. Overall, these technologies foster innovation across sectors by expanding creative possibilities and improving practical applications.
